The daughter of an American international businessman, Elizabeth
Evans grew up in three different countries in Asia. Seeing herself
as an adopted daughter of Asia, the region became part of her
identity and her soul. When she and her husband had three sons,
they thought their family was complete, but fate had other plans
for them. When they set out to adopt a daughter into their
boy-majority family, they looked to the Eurasian country of
Kazakhstan. Their adoption trip had too many tense moments, with
missed flights, scary Russian officials and spy-novel worthy
checkpoints. Elizabeth doesn't hold back in talking about the
difficult aftermath of adoption, something that she feels is
important to share to reassure adoptive parents that they are never
alone in their journey.
